Key duties and tasks:
- Auditioning the singers and making casting recommendations to the director.
- Scheduling music rehearsals in collaboration with the director and choreographer.
- Helping cast members learn music in large group and individual instruction as required.
- Leading music rehearsals for principals, chorus and orchestra.
- Serving as conductor for performances.
- In consultation with the producer and director, guide creative process for production.
- Working with the sound designer when microphones will be used.
- Attending production meetings and rehearsals.
